The set of three that can have maximum magnitudes at the same instant of time will be displacement, acceleration, and potential energy.

What is simple harmonic motion?

Simple harmonic motion is periodic motion caused by a restoring force that is proportionate to the deviation from equilibrium.

Simple harmonic motion is periodic motion but many other conditions are dependent.

The object is in simple harmonic motion of the following quantities related to the object.

The set of three that can have maximum magnitudes at the same instant of time will be displacement, acceleration, and potential energy.

Hence the set of three quantities is the options i, iii,v.
